1972 Plymouth Road Runner – Rotisserie Restored, Matching Numbers, Modern Upgrades
This 1972 Plymouth Road Runner has undergone a full rotisserie restoration with over $140,000 in documented receipts. It blends factory-original character with upgraded performance for a modern driving experience, all while retaining its matching-numbers drivetrain.
The body was meticulously prepped and fitted, resulting in one of the straightest, best-aligned Mopars we’ve ever owned. It’s finished in its factory Lemon Twist Yellow, repainted in base/clear and polished to a show-quality shine. The look is enhanced by factory Black Transverse stripes and rear spoiler, along with dual mirrors and the correct 340 hood. Both bumpers were refinished to a high standard and fit perfectly. All glass is in excellent condition with new seals and weatherstripping. The stance is completed with custom Billet Specialties wheels – 18-inch front, 20-inch rear – wrapped in new Toyo tires.
Inside, the black interior was restored to match the factory spec. New carpet, headliner, and door panels were installed, along with completely redone front and rear bench seats. The dash features a custom gauge setup with a tachometer and controls for the Holley Sniper EFI system. It also has Vintage Air heat and A/C, a custom steering wheel, and retains its factory four-speed transmission with the iconic Pistol Grip shifter. The trunk is clean and detailed, with carpet, relocated battery, spare, and kill switch.
Under the hood, the attention to detail continues. The matching-numbers 340 V8 is equipped with Holley Sniper fuel injection, a custom dual-snorkel air cleaner, Mopar Performance valve covers, and a polished serpentine belt system. It also has power steering, four-wheel power disc brakes, an aluminum radiator, and dual electric fans. The matching-numbers 4-speed transmission and original Sure Grip rear end with 3.23 gears put the power to the pavement. Underneath, the floors and frame are solid and beautifully detailed. Suspension components, fuel system, and brake lines were all replaced during the restoration. The exhaust setup features headers, dual pipes, and MagnaFlow mufflers.
This Road Runner is an exceptional example of high-end restoration paired with modern usability and muscle car pedigree. It runs, drives, and shows just as impressively as it looks. Ready for the street or the show field.
